Storm window installation services involve attaching additional windows to existing window frames to provide an extra layer of protection against the elements. These services typically include measuring, selecting appropriate storm windows, and securely installing them to ensure a proper fit. The process may also involve sealing and weatherproofing to prevent drafts, moisture infiltration, and air leaks. Professional installers focus on ensuring that the storm windows function correctly and enhance the overall insulation of a property.
One of the primary benefits of storm window installation is its ability to address issues related to energy efficiency. By adding an extra barrier, storm windows help reduce heat loss during colder months, which can lead to lower heating costs. They also help block drafts and minimize the infiltration of dust, pollen, and insects, contributing to a more comfortable indoor environment. Additionally, storm windows can protect existing windows from damage caused by harsh weather conditions, such as hail, wind, or heavy rain.
Properties that commonly utilize storm window installation services include residential homes, especially older or historic houses that may not have modern insulation features. Commercial buildings, such as retail storefronts and office spaces, can also benefit from storm windows to improve energy efficiency and occupant comfort. In regions with significant seasonal weather changes, both homeowners and business owners find storm windows to be a practical solution for maintaining indoor climate control and protecting windows from the elements.

Material Costs - The cost of storm windows materials typically ranges from $50 to $150 per window, depending on the quality and type of materials used. For example, a standard double-pane storm window may fall within this range.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on your selected options.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or costs generally vary between $100 and $300 per window. Factors influencing this include window size, number of windows, and installation complexity. Contact local service providers for tailored quotes in your area.
Total Project Costs - Overall costs for installing storm windows can range from $200 to $600 per window, combining materials and labor. Larger projects or custom installations may increase this estimate. Local contractors can help determine precise pricing based on your needs.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for removal of old windows, custom sizing, or special features, potentially adding $50 to $200 per window. These costs vary by project and provider, so consulting local pros is recommended for accurate est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are storm windows? Storm windows are additional window panels installed on the exterior or interior of existing windows to provide extra insulation and protection against the elements.
How long does storm window installation typically take? Installation times can vary depending on the number of windows and their type, but many projects are completed within a day or two by local service providers.
Are storm windows suitable for all types of homes? Storm windows are generally suitable for most residential properties, though a professional can assess compatibility based on the home's design and window styles.
Can storm windows be installed on existing windows without removal? Yes, many storm window systems are designed for easy installation over existing windows without the need for removal or major modifications.
